Would you like to contribute to the conservation of adders in the North Pennines National Landscape?

Learn how to survey for adders and other reptiles and amphibians in the North Pennines. Training will follow on from the adder survey training webinar, covering safety, animal identification and survey techniques.

The training at Slaley Forest, Northumberland is on 19 March, 9am to 12.30pm. Full details of the meeting point will be given when signing up to volunteer.

There are two other opportunities available, 20 and 26 March at different locations.

The session is suitable for adults, and children over the age of 12 who are supervised. Unsuitable for wheelchairs, dogs and young children.
